Battery drains
When sitting still and car is not running, the battery will drain in a matter of minutes and requires a boost to start.
It happened again to my wife this week when she was waiting for my boy to finish a class.
Sitting in the car, lsitening to tunes but not running, the battery goes flat.
Dearler checked battery and say it's ok.
Ideas?

Would take it to another shop, perhaps an Advance Auto Parts, AutoZone, or Costco, where they will check your battery and your vehicle's charging system for free. Just running the radio should not be enough to drain a good battery.

Seems to be the battery is on it's way out, maybe a cell is bad.
With the engine on, the alternator supplies enough current for everything to function.
Engine off you're using battery power only, while it might not seem like just the radio alone would drain it, the battery doesn't have enough volts or amps to turn the starter.
Have it load tested at a local auto store as previously posted (usually for free) they'll even replace it. Then you'll need to have the power windows and sunroof reinitialized for auto function
